aboutsummaryrefslogtreecommitdiff
;;; GNU Guix --- Functional package management for GNU ;;; Copyright © 2013 Andreas Enge <andreas@enge.fr> ;;; Copyright © 2014, 2015 Mark H Weaver <mhw@netris.org> ;;; Copyright © 2016-2018, 2022, 2023 Efraim Flashner <efraim@flashner.co.il> ;;; Copyright © 2018 Tobias Geerinckx-Rice <me@tobias.gr> ;;; Copyright © 2020 Michael Rohleder <mike@rohleder.de> ;;; Copyright © 2021 Marius Bakke <marius@gnu.org> ;;; ;;; This file is part of GNU Guix. ;;; ;;; GNU Guix is free software; you can redistribute it and/or modify it ;;; under the terms of the GNU General Public License as published by ;;; the Free Software Foundation; either version 3 of the License, or (at ;;; your option) any later version. ;;; ;;; GNU Guix is distributed in the hope that it will be useful, but ;;; WITHOUT ANY WARRANTY; without even the implied warranty of ;;; M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the ;;; GNU General Public License for more details. ;;; ;;; You should have received a copy of the GNU General Public License ;;; along with GNU Guix. If not, see <http://www.gnu.org/licenses/>. (define-module (gnu packages file) #:use-module (gnu packages) #:use-module (guix licenses) #:use-module (guix packages) #:use-module (guix download) #:use-module (guix build-system gnu)) (define-public file (package (name "file") (version "5.45") (source (origin (method url-fetch) (uri (string-append "http://ftp.astron.com/pub/file/file-" version ".tar.gz")) (sha256 (base32 "10jdg2fd19h2q3jrsaw7xqwy1w3qyvdfzzrv9sgjq3mv548gb5zw")) (patches (search-patches "file-32bit-time.patch")))) (build-system gnu-build-system) ;; When cross-compiling, this package depends upon a native install of ;; itself. (native-inputs (if (%current-target-system) `(("self" ,this-package)) '())) (synopsis "File type guesser") (description "The file command is a file type guesser, a command-line tool that tells you in words what kind of data a file contains. It does not rely on filename extensions to tell you the type of a file, but looks at the actual contents of the file. This package provides the libmagic library.") (license bsd-2) (home-page "https://www.darwinsys.com/file/"))) 5-06-21
Merge branch 'master' into core-updatesMark H Weaver
2015-06-21gnu: jemalloc: Build with gcc-4.8 on i686....Mark H Weaver
2015-06-21gnu: lame: Build with gcc-4.8 on i686....Mark H Weaver
2015-06-21gnu: Add fasttree....Ben Woodcroft
2015-06-21gnu: ffmpeg: Update to 2.7.1....Mark H Weaver
2015-06-20gnu: totem-pl-parser: Add gobject-introspection support....Mark H Weaver
2015-06-20gnu: totem-pl-parser: Move glib, gmime, and libxml2 to propagated-inputs....Mark H Weaver
2015-06-20gnu: gsl: Fix poly test on i686....Mark H Weaver
2015-06-19gnu: gnome-doc-utils: Add python2-libxml2 to native-inputs....Mark H Weaver
2015-06-19gnu: itstool: Add python2-libxml2 to propagated-inputs....Mark H Weaver
2015-06-19gnu: mdadm: Add compilation fix for gcc-4.9....Mark H Weaver
2015-06-19gnu: clang: Build without debugging symbols....Ludovic Courtès
2015-06-19gnu: clang: Allow 'clang' to link executables....Ludovic Courtès
2015-06-19gnu: clang: Add search path specifications....Ludovic Courtès
2015-06-19gnu: Add libstdc++ as a standalone package....Ludovic Courtès
2015-06-19gnu: Add ruby 2.1.6...pjotrp
2015-06-19gnu: Make 'mount' interface in static Guile consistent with Guix API....David Thompson
2015-06-19gnu: unrtf: Update to 0.21.9....Ludovic Courtès
2015-06-19gnu: Add Raul....Ricardo Wurmus
2015-06-18Merge branch 'master' into core-updatesMark H Weaver
2015-06-18gnu: vamp: Update to 2.6....Ricardo Wurmus
2015-06-18gnu: Add zita-resampler....Ricardo Wurmus
2015-06-18gnu: Add Faust....Ricardo Wurmus
2015-06-18gnu: Add Qsynth....Ricardo Wurmus
2015-06-18gnu: swig: Update to 3.0.5....Mark H Weaver
2015-06-18gnu: ocaml: Update gcc:lib input to gcc-4.9....Mark H Weaver
2015-06-18Merge branch 'master' into core-updatesMark H Weaver
2015-06-18gnu: guix: Update snapshot....Mark H Weaver
2015-06-17gnu: cpio: Fix symlink-bad-length test....Mark H Weaver
2015-06-17gnu: Add diamond....Ben Woodcroft
2015-06-18gnu: ocaml: Don't rely on (gnu packages commencement)....Ludovic Courtès
2015-06-17gnu: guix: Update snapshot....Mark H Weaver
2015-06-17gnu: miso: Use HTTPS URL....Ricardo Wurmus
2015-06-17gnu: bedops: Update to 2.4.14....Ricardo Wurmus
2015-06-17gnu: Add wayland....宋文武
2015-06-16gnu: talloc: Change source URI to use https....Mark H Weaver
2015-06-16gnu: qt: Add more inputs....宋文武
2015-06-16gnu: Add libmng....宋文武
2015-06-16gnu: qt: Update to 5.4.2....宋文武
2015-06-16gnu: qt-4: Update to 4.8.7....宋文武
2015-06-16gnu: talloc: Update to 2.1.2....宋文武